The Great Divide: Hemp vs. Marijuana-Derived CBD
Here's the thing: Oklahoma, bless its free-spirited heart, allows both medical marijuana and hemp-derived CBD. But there's a crucial distinction, like the difference between your grandma's bridge game and a mosh pit.
- Hemp-derived CBD: This is the good stuff for regular folks (18 and over, of course). It comes from the hemp plant, a low-THC relative of marijuana, and won't make you see a friendly purple dragon behind your eyelids. You can find it in many stores, including dispensaries (more on that later).
- Marijuana-derived CBD: This one requires a medical marijuana card. It has a higher concentration of THC, the psychoactive compound in marijuana, and offers stronger potential benefits, but also the risk of feeling a little too "high" for comfort.
Dispensary Adventures: Card or No Card?
Now, about those dispensaries. They're like Willy Wonka's chocolate factory for adults, but with more calming vibes and less chance of encountering a creepy Oompa Loompa. Here's the deal:
- Card Required for Marijuana-derived CBD: If you're after the marijuana-derived CBD, you'll need to show your medical marijuana card at the dispensary door. It's like a passport to a world of relaxation, but with a little more paperwork involved.
- Welcome Wagon for Hemp-derived CBD: But for hemp-derived CBD? Dispensaries often stock a wide variety! They might even have a knowledgeable staff who can help you find the perfect product for your needs.
But wait, there's more! Dispensaries can be a great resource for high-quality CBD products, but they might not always be the most affordable option. Consider checking out other stores like health food shops or vape shops for competitive prices.

Remember: Always check the label! Make sure the CBD is hemp-derived (less than 0.3% THC) to avoid any legal troubles.
